Understanding Advance Auto Parts Inc.

Advance Auto Parts Inc. is a leading automotive aftermarket parts provider in North America. The company offers a wide range of parts, accessories, and maintenance services for vehicles. Its extensive product portfolio includes everything from batteries and brakes to tires and engine parts.

What are Non-voting Shares?

Non-voting shares are a type of stock that does not grant shareholders the right to vote on corporate matters. While these shares do not offer voting rights, they often come with other benefits, such as dividends and capital appreciation.
